Morning Routine
Models tend to wake up early in the morning to make the most of their day. The exact time varies among individuals, but it is common for models to wake up around 6:30 am to 7 am. Some like Kendall Jenner prefer to rise around 6:30 am, while others like Gigi Hadid start their day at around 7 am. Georgia Fowler, on the other hand, begins her day at approximately 5 am when she has work scheduled (The Models Kit).
After waking up, models often follow a skincare routine to maintain their complexion and prepare their skin for the demands of the day. This may include cleansing, moisturizing, and applying sunscreen to protect their skin during outdoor photoshoots.
Workout Regimen
To keep their bodies in peak physical condition, fashion models incorporate regular exercise into their daily routines. The frequency and intensity of workouts may vary depending on individual preferences and schedules.
Stella Maxwell, for example, typically works out around four to five times a week, dedicating one hour to each session. She prefers working out later at night and focuses on gradually building intensity rather than overexerting herself (Byrdie).
Josephine Skriver, another well-known model, emphasizes the importance of finding a workout routine that is enjoyable and effective for your body. She personally finds weight training to be effective and goes to the gym approximately five days a week. She also incorporates cardio exercises once or twice a week for overall cardiovascular health.
The specific exercises and workouts may vary, but many models focus on a combination of strength training, cardio exercises, and flexibility training. This comprehensive approach helps them maintain a toned physique, improve endurance, and enhance overall fitness.
It’s important to note that every model’s workout regimen is tailored to their individual needs and goals. Some models may work out more frequently or focus on specific areas of their body, depending on the requirements of their work and personal preferences.

Importance of Rest and Recovery
Rest and recovery play a vital role in the fitness routines of fashion models. While it may be tempting to push the limits and constantly train, overtraining can have negative consequences on both physical and mental well-being. That’s why models, including Victoria’s Secret models, prioritize rest and recovery as part of their workout routines (Rachael Attard).
Sufficient sleep is essential for optimal recovery. It allows the body to repair and rebuild muscles, regulate hormones, and recharge for the next day’s activities. Models understand the importance of getting enough sleep to support their overall health and fitness goals.
In addition to sleep, stretching and foam rolling are common practices among fashion models. These activities help improve flexibility, increase blood flow to the muscles, and alleviate muscle tension. By incorporating stretching and foam rolling into their routines, models can enhance their range of motion and reduce the risk of injuries.
Nutrition and Diet
Proper nutrition and a balanced diet are key components of a fashion model’s fitness regimen. The food choices models make can significantly impact their energy levels, physical appearance, and overall health. While there are various diet plans followed by models, it’s important to find an approach that works best for individual needs and goals.
One popular diet plan often associated with Victoria’s Secret models is the Victoria’s Secret Model Diet. This diet emphasizes whole foods such as fruits, vegetables, whole grains, proteins, and healthy fats while restricting processed foods, refined grains, added sugars, and alcohol (Healthline). However, it is important to note that this diet may set unrealistic goals for most people and may not consider individual differences in nutritional needs.

Strength Training for Fashion Models
Strength training plays a crucial role in the workout routines of fashion models, helping them build lean muscle and support their overall physique. When it comes to strength training, fashion models often focus on two key aspects: weightlifting versus bodyweight exercises and targeting specific muscle groups.
Weightlifting vs. Bodyweight Exercises
There are varying approaches within the modeling industry when it comes to weightlifting. Some models, like Victoria’s Secret models, often avoid heavy lifting and stick to weights that are no heavier than 5-10 pounds (2-5 kilograms) to prevent unwanted bulk. However, it’s worth noting that there are also models who incorporate heavy lifting into their routines, usually combining it with lighter exercises to achieve their desired results (Rachael Attard).
Weightlifting, especially with free weights, engages the core more and can help maintain a firmer midsection. The level of muscularity achieved depends on the amount of stress placed on a given muscle group, with free weights often leading to more noticeable muscular gains.
Bodyweight exercises also play a significant role in the strength training routines of fashion models. These exercises use the body’s weight as resistance and can be done anywhere, making them convenient for models who are often on the go. Bodyweight exercises help improve strength, endurance, and overall muscle tone.
Targeting Specific Muscle Groups
To achieve a well-balanced and proportionate physique, fashion models often incorporate exercises that target specific muscle groups. By focusing on targeted areas, models can enhance their overall aesthetic and create a harmonious physique.
Models may perform exercises that target the core, such as planks, crunches, or Russian twists, to help maintain a strong and defined midsection. Additionally, exercises that target the legs and glutes, such as squats, lunges, and hip thrusts, are common to create toned and shapely lower body muscles. Upper body exercises like push-ups, pull-ups, and shoulder presses may also be included to develop strength and definition in the arms, shoulders, and back.

Balancing Modeling Career and Fitness
For fashion models, balancing a demanding modeling career with maintaining a fit and healthy lifestyle can be a challenge. The irregular work hours and unpredictable schedule of a model require careful time management and flexibility. Let’s take a closer look at the factors that models face when it comes to balancing their career and fitness.
Irregular Work Hours
One of the unique aspects of a modeling career is the irregular work hours. Models may have varying schedules, ranging from a few hours to several days a week, depending on industry demands and individual contracts (Quora). Some models work full-time, while others have part-time or freelance schedules. This variability necessitates flexibility and adaptability when it comes to managing time and fitting in fitness routines.
Being prepared for sudden photo shoots, castings, or fashion events can be demanding. Models often spend considerable time preparing for events, managing hair, clothes, and makeup not only for themselves but also for other models. This additional coordination and preparation can further complicate scheduling and time management (Quora).
